Announcing the 2025 Bursary recipient a multi-disciplinary company One Two One Two led by Zoe Ní Riordáin and Maud Lee.

In accepting the award they said "We are at a stage in our career and practice where we are confident in our work. As makers we have always been rigorous in our research and development process. This bursary offers us the opportunity to challenge ourselves to go further with this rigour, to deepen our understanding of movement and let our imaginations be limitless. We will be led by Emma's spirit of courage, curiosity and ambition and follow her motto of "Go big or go home!" Thank you this amazing opportunity. We are very grateful."

 

ABOUT 

One Two One Two is a multi-disciplinary company led by Zoe Ní Riordáin and Maud Lee. They make heartfelt, collaborative and original work in English and Irish. Their theatre projects include the highly acclaimed The Well Rested Terrorist, Recovery (Romilly Walton Masters award), Everything I Do (Best Performer Fringe awards). Since 2020, they have made a suite of award-winning Irish language films inspired by the opera Carmen; Dúirt Tú (you said), Tar Anseo (come here) and Éist liom (listen to me). They have toured Ireland, Paris, Edinburgh Fringe 2019. Maud and Zoe co-directed The Sound of The Northside with the Kabin Crew in Knocknaheeny, a hip-hop opera featuring Irish National Opera ensemble. They wrote the Kabin Christmas Special for RTÉ Television. They are co-artistic directors, with Zoe leading on creative development, and Maud leading on strategic development, and they share the artistic direction of the company, alternating between writing, directing and performing in the work.

Zoe Ní Riordáin

Zoe Ní Riordáin is a theatre, filmmaker and musician from Dublin, committed to making challenging and heartfelt work with a spirit of adventure. Her practice as a writer, director, songwriter and performer is based on collaboration and drawing from a wide range of disciplines. Zoe is co-artistic director of One Two One Two with Maud Lee. Their award-winning work in theatre, film and music has toured nationally and internationally since 2014. Film projects include Tar Anseo (come here) featuring Seána Kerslake and Peter Coonan (Best Director award at Fastnet Film Festival ’23, Dúirt Tú (you said), (Best Director at Cork International Film Festival 2020). Zoe was a 2023 Clore Fellow. She was selected as a participant in X-Pollinator, a film initiative of Screen Ireland in 2024. In 2024, Zoe co-directed ‘Sound Of The Northside’  a hip-hop opera with Kabin Studio, Cork in collaboration with Irish National Opera. She is currently directing a music/theatre piece, ‘History of Life’ for Spoleto Festival USA featuring Iarla Ó Lionaird.

Maud Lee
Maud Lee is a theatre and film maker, musician and performer, working primarily with the company One Two One Two which she founded with Zoe Ní Riordáin. As co-artistic directors, Zoe and Maud have created experimental, multi-disciplinary work since 2014. They make ambitious, heartfelt work for theatre, film and music in Irish and English. Selected projects include short films Dúirt Tú ( winner best director Cork Film Festival ) and Tar Anseo (winner of Best Direction at Fastnet Film Festival), theatre/music piece Everything I Do (winner of Best Performer Dublin Fringe 2018) and Sound of the Northside, a hip- opera in collaboration with Kabin Studio, Cork. Maud performs and co-directs the projects, and as a trained violinist and songwriter, focuses on the music aspect of the work.
